Fulham 0-2 Chelsea

 

Chelsea continued their fine start to the season beating Fulham 0-2 at Craven Cottage in the London derby to sit pretty at the top of the premiership table equal on points with Tottenham.

 

The Blues had to come back from a goal down in their previous two games against Hull City and Sunderland, but this time it was a different story. Michael Ballack could have given Chelsea the lead in the 12th minute itself when Didier Drogba won a free kick at the edge of the penalty box. However the German ace shot just a yard over.

John Obi Mikel unleashed a fierce drive from 20 yards out in the 21st minute, but his hot flew just wide much to the relief of the Cottagers goalkeeper Mark Schwarzer. Didier Drogba finally broke the deadlock in the 39th minute of the game when Nicolas Anelka's delicate through ball landed at his feet.

 

Drogba's fine connection made a mockery of experts who felt the Ivory Coast international could not pair up with Anelka. Chelsea defender Ricardo Carvalho almost scored an own goal in the 50th minute when he headed over Murphy's cross. It was in the 76th minute that Chelsea sealed the game when Drogba returned the favour by passing to Anelka who shot in his first goal of the campaign.

 

Manager Carlo Ancelotti was delighted with his side's showing and insisted that Drogba and Anelka could play together, while Fulham boss Roy Hodgson will hope his side can pull up their socks for their next game.
